Case Notes
This case involves a 36-year-old female patient who underwent bilateral breast augmentation. The procedure utilized 300-320cc Mentor Moderate Classic silicone gel implants, placed in the subfascial plane through an inframammary incision. Pre-operatively, the patient had a B cup size, which increased to a C cup post-operatively. The images show changes in breast volume and contour six months after surgery, with the round implants contributing to enhanced fullness and projection. The moderate profile of the implants provides a natural appearance consistent with the patient's body proportions.
